Signs That It's Time to Call a Professional


While DIY tasks can deal with basic upkeep, some fixings require a professional touch. Modern vehicles are loaded with sophisticated modern technology that requires unique diagnostic tools and professional training. Systems like steering and suspension repair aren't simply made complex-- they're important to your security when traveling.


If you discover signs and symptoms like unequal tire wear, relentless pulling to one side, clunking sounds over bumps, or a loosened guiding wheel, it's a sign that you require a specialist assessment. Ignoring concerns with guiding or suspension can put you and others at serious danger. While it may be tempting to repair in the house, fixings in these locations need to be delegated service technicians that recognize the fragile balance your car requires to run safely.
